How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or may well be got rid of from the road of succession to the throne

February 24, 2026
How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or may well be got rid of from the road of succession to the throne
SHARE

On October 30, 2025, King Charles III withdrew the name of prince from his more youthful brother Andrew, because of the invention of the shut courting between the latter and the kid prison Jeffrey Epstein (Andrew particularly agreed to pay a big sum to Virginia Giuffre, some of the sufferers of Epstein’s intercourse trafficking). The previous prince is now referred to as “simply”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or, however stays provide within the line of succession to the British crown to these days. New paperwork in terms of the Epstein affair which have been launched just lately are actually pushing the monarchy to exclude him from this line of succession, which might even have a right away have an effect on on different royal entities throughout the Commonwealth, beginning with Australia.

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or’s position within the line of succession to the British throne seems to be in jeopardy.

Mountbatten-Windsor is recently 8th in line of succession (after Prince William and his 3 kids, then Prince Harry and his two kids) to the crown of the UK and all fifteen Commonwealth geographical regions. It’s subsequently not likely that he’ll sooner or later change into a monarch, however rejecting him could be essentially a symbolic act.

Is it imaginable to take away him from the road of succession? The solution is sure – however it might take time and will require the adoption of choices to that impact via many parliaments. This factor is especially alive as of late in Australia, some of the fifteen Commonwealth kingdoms.

Does the road of succession practice to the British and Australian crowns?

When Australia received independence in 1901, the British Crown was once described as “one and indivisible”. Queen Victoria workouts constitutional powers over all her colonies, depending at the recommendation of British ministers.

However after the First Global Battle, this dynamic modified, following a sequence of imperial meetings. In 1930 the self sufficient “Dominions” (Australia, Canada, New Zealand, South Africa, the Irish Loose State and Newfoundland) gained their very own crowns. Thus, the Australian High Minister now has the suitable to advise the monarch at the appointment of the Governor-Basic of Australia and on different Australian federal issues.

On the other hand, the rules of succession of those quite a lot of crowns stay the similar. This can be a motley mixture of English regulation, together with common regulations in terms of inheritance and paperwork such because the 1689 Invoice of Rights and the 1701 Act of Agreement.

Those rules become a part of Australian regulation within the 18th century, however for a very long time Australian parliaments didn’t have the option to amend them. On the other hand, the passage of the Statute of Westminster in 1931 modified issues. This constitution offers the dominions the ability to repeal or adjust British rules in power of their nation.

On the other hand, as this may create headaches with regards to the succession to the crown, a paragraph was once incorporated within the preamble of the textual content declaring that “any modification of the law relating to the succession to the throne” should be licensed via the parliaments of all of the Dominions in addition to the UK. Article 4 of the Statute keeps the ability of the British Parliament to legislate for the kingdom, however simplest on the request and with the consent of the latter.

In 1936, when King Edward VIII abdicated, the British Parliament handed a regulation converting the foundations of succession to exclude any kids the king may have. Australia is of the same opinion that this British regulation applies in its territory.

For the reason that enactment of phase 1 of the Australia Act 1986, no act of the British Parliament can now shape a part of the regulation of the Commonwealth, any state or territory of Australia. Any adjustments to the foundations of succession to the Australian Crown should subsequently be made in Australia.

How may Australia exchange inheritance regulation?

When the Commonwealth Charter was once followed, the Crown was once nonetheless thought to be “one and indivisible”. Subsequently, no provision was once made to present the Commonwealth Parliament the ability to legislate on succession to the Crown. On the other hand, the framers of the charter supplied a mechanism to maintain this sort of unexpected construction.

Segment 51(kkkviii) of the Charter supplies that the Parliament of the Commonwealth of Australia would possibly workout an influence which in 1901 was once vested solely within the British Parliament, topic to the request or consent of all States involved. Which means the Commonwealth Parliament and the states can paintings in combination to switch Australia’s regulations of succession to the Crown.

The problem arose in 2011, when quite a lot of Commonwealth kingdoms (this is, nations that also known Queen Elizabeth II as head of state) agreed to switch the foundations of succession to take away male personal tastes and exclude heirs who married a Catholic.

The British Parliament handed the Succession to the Crown Act in 2013 to put in force this reform. On the other hand, he not on time its access into power till different kingdoms followed identical provisions. British regulation simplest modified the succession to the crown of the UK.

Some kingdoms felt they had to exchange their inner regulation. Others felt that this was once no longer important, as their Charter routinely designated because the sovereign one who was once the King or Queen of the UK. Sooner or later, rules had been handed in Australia, Barbados, Canada, New Zealand, St. Kitts and Nevis, and St. Vincent and the Grenadines.

In Australia, each and every of the states handed regulation referred to as the Succession to the Crown Act 2015. Australia’s procedure was once long, because of differing legislative priorities, parliamentary calendars and state election sessions.

Australia was once the final nation to go its personal regulation. The exchange of succession then took impact concurrently in all of the kingdoms affected.

How would the method paintings as of late?

If taking away Mountbatten-Windsor from the road of succession had been to be thought to be as of late, the British govt would almost certainly first search settlement from the opposite Commonwealth geographical regions. Despite the fact that no longer legally required, session is essential to keeping up a shared monarch.

The British Parliament would then get ready a draft regulation that might function a fashion for different jurisdictions, to verify uniformity of regulations. The textual content would specify whether or not the exclusion of Mountbatten-Windsor would additionally worry his heirs, Princesses Beatrice and Eugenie, in addition to their kids. Beneath the outdated regulation, a member of the royal circle of relatives who married a Catholic was once thought to be legally “dead” in order that the inheritance rights in their descendants would no longer be compromised. A similar resolution may well be followed within the Mountbatten-Windsor case.

The similar parliaments that handed the rules all the way through the former reform (except Barbados, which become a republic) must vote for an similar regulation in the event that they sought after to stay the an identical regulations. On the other hand, the presentation of this kind of textual content may open a much broader debate concerning the function of the monarchy in those other states.

May just Australia act by myself?

Australia may, in principle, go regulation by itself to take away Mountbatten-Windsor from the succession to the Australian crown. On the other hand, it’s not likely that they’re going to achieve this.

First, it might require a posh legislative procedure, mobilizing seven parliaments to go a measure that might most likely have little sensible impact, given Mountbatten-Windsor’s far-off position within the order of succession.

Subsequent, clause 2 of the introductory provisions of the Commonwealth Charter supplies {that a} connection with “the Queen” extends to “her heirs and successors in the sovereignty of the United Kingdom”. However is it only a rule of utilization or does this provision produce substantive criminal results?

For plenty of, keeping up the similar inheritance regulations in Australia and the United Kingdom avoids opening Pandora’s Field.
